Job Duties

Provide support for Energy Management Systems (EMS) power systems applications portfolio such as Power Flow, State Estimator, Contingency Analysis, Load Frequency Control, Dynamic Stability Analysis, Load Forecasting, Operator Training Simulator (OTS) etc. Design, develop, test, validate, and implement modifications and enhancements to EMS applications. Perform EMS network model load testing on periodic basis and update the model data in real-time based on established procedures. Design and test EMS Interfaces and Web & Client/Server applications changes. Verify and support EMS applications during system site failovers, server/system/database upgrades and patching. Support execution of Disaster Recovery Drills and business continuity procedures. Maintain, troubleshoot and repair EMS and OTS applications and interfaces, and escalate as appropriate. Act as a consultant, representative and subject matter expert in project and activities that affect the EMS and OTS environments and applications as appropriate. Participates in multifunctional teams to obtain input, address comments and provide application support. Represent the EMS Applications Engineering Team at interdepartmental and Stakeholder meetings. Provides on the job training or help oversee the work of other engineer/analysts. May act as mentor and advisor to less experienced engineers/analysts. Works independently on assignments and projects. Participates in multifunctional teams to perform studies. Assist in developing tools, processes and procedures that enhance system reliability and departmental/organizational efficiencies. Participates with other ERCOT departments to select and implement system changes as needed. Serves as the technical Subject Matter Expert for the department. Serve as a Technical Lead for EMS portfolio projects and drive the implementation for incubation to go-live. Make independent decisions except in instances of unusually complex application scenarios. Works on the most complex application issues where analysis of situations requires an in-depth evaluation of variable factors. Works with database administrators and infrastructure teams on complex EMS application issues triggered from server, network, storage, and/or database components. Tests Non-Functional requirements of EMS application changes and coordinates with database/infrastructure teams to perform the tests. Fosters and leverages strong working relationships with other internal departments. Lends professional expertise to guide projects and help teammates assigned by manager. Demonstrates skills as an expert user of power system software applications and tools, spreadsheet programs, and database programs. Maintain knowledge of emerging trends and industry best practices. Minimum Education

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Computer Science or related field.

Minimum Experience

Eight (8) years of experience as Application Developer or Software Engineer.

Special Requirements

The required eight (8) years of experience as Application Developer or Software Engineer must have included Energy Management Systems (Power Systems) for the electric utility industry.
